Abstract
The adsorption equilibria of water vapor on zeolite 3A, zeolite 13X, and dealuminated Y zeolite (DAY) were measured using a volumetric method. Equilibrium experiments were conducted at 293.15, 303.15, and 313.15 K and at relative pressure (P/Ps) up to 0.95. Experimental data were correlated using Aranovich-Donohue and Frenkel-Halsey-Hill models, using Langmuir, Toth, UNILAN, and Sips isotherms.
